Respondents PRAYER: Writ Petition is filed under Article 226 of the Constitution of India, for issuance of Writ of Mandamus, directing the 1st respondent to consider the petitioner's complaint dated 18.09.2024 thereby conduct proper enquiry and investigate into the death of her son, Vijay S/o. Selvarasu, aged about 20 years on 18.06.2024 registered in Crime No.473/2024 and identify the vehicle.

For Petitioner : Mr.J.Milton Arul Rajendran For Respondents : Mr.A.Gopinath Government Advocate (Crl. Side)

ORDER

The petition is filed for a direction directing the first respondent to consider the representation submitted by the petitioner seeking proper investigation in Crime No.473 of 2024 registered on the file of the 2nd respondent.

2. The petitioner's son met with an accident and died, due to which the second respondent registered the Crime No.473 of 2024 for the offence under Sections 279 & 304 IPC. It is the case of hit and run and the second respondent is yet to trace out the vehicle which was involved in the accident. Therefore, the second respondent is directed to complete the investigation in Crime No.473 of 2024 within a period of twelve we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order and file a final report within twelve weeks.

3. With the above direction, this Writ Petition is disposed of. No costs.
